Dec 27 (Reuters) - Lionel Messi will return to Paris St Germain at the beginning of January, the Ligue 1 club's manager Christophe Galtier said on Tuesday. The Argentine forward, seven-times Ballon D'Or winner, scored two goals to lead his country to victory over France on penalties in the World Cup final nine days ago. The 35-year-old Messi will miss PSG's home league game against Strasbourg on Wednesday and the trip to Lens on Sunday. PSG are top of the standings on 41 points after 15 games, five above second-placed Lens. AL KHOR, Qatar, Dec 1 (Reuters) - France's Stephanie Frappart made history on Thursday when she became the first woman to take charge of a men's World Cup finals game during Costa Rica's Group E match against Germany. Frappart, 38, led the first all-female refereeing team in a men's World Cup in the game at the Al Bayt Stadium alongside assistants Neuza Back from Brazil and Mexico's Karen Diaz. Frappart entered the history books when she became the first woman to referee a French Ligue 1 match in 2019, officiating a game between Amiens and Strasbourg. The same year, Frappart also took charge of the UEFA Super Cup between Liverpool and Chelsea, becoming the first woman to officiate in a major men's European match. "The men's World Cup is the most important sporting competition in the world," said Frappart, who was also the fourth official during Mexico's goalless draw with Poland at the Qatar World Cup.

Nov 16 (Reuters) - Burnley winger Anass Zaroury has been called up by Morocco coach Walid Regragui for his World Cup squad in place of injured forward Amine Harit, the Moroccan FA said on Wednesday. Marseille's Harit sustained a knee injury during a Ligue 1 match against AS Monaco on Sunday, which later turned out to be a sprain of the cruciate ligaments of the left knee. read more"Zaroury's call-up was made official following his official qualification by FIFA on Wednesday," the Moroccan FA said on its website. Morocco start their World Cup campaign on Nov. 23 against Croatia and also face Belgium and Canada in Group F.Reporting by Anita Kobylinska in Gdansk Editing by Toby DavisOur Standards: The Thomson Reuters Trust Principles.

Nov 6 (Reuters) - Danilo's late header helped unbeaten Ligue 1 leaders Paris St Germain beat a lively Lorient side 2-1 at the Stade du Moustoir on Sunday, after Terem Moffi's brilliant second-half goal had cancelled out Neymar's early opener for the visitors. Lorient's top-scorer Moffi made amends nine minutes into the second half after being set up by Enzo Le Fee's through ball, rifling his shot over PSG goalkeeper Gianluigi Donnarumma for his ninth league goal of the season. Moffi was inches away from putting Lorient ahead but his shot struck the crossbar and the hosts weathered an intense period of pressure from PSG before Danilo powered his header from Neymar's corner past Mannone in the 81st minute. PSG, with 38 points from 14 games, restored their five-point cushion over second-placed Lens while Lorient remained fourth, level on 27 points with Rennes before their Brittany rivals travel to Lille later on Sunday. Summary Real Madrid's Frenchman Benzema voted best men's playerBarca's Spain midfielder Putellas picks up women's awardpep Guardiola's Manchester City chosen as Best ClubPARIS, Oct 17 (Reuters) - Real Madrid's France forward Karim Benzema won the 2022 Ballon d'Or award for the best men's player in the world on Monday, while Barcelona's Spain midfielder Alexia Putellas won the women's award for a second time. Benzema had a stellar season with Real, scoring 44 goals in 46 games in all competitions as he helped guide them to a LaLiga and Champions League double. His 15 goals in the Champions League guided Real to a record-extending 14th title. Putellas, who was also named FIFA Best Women's Player earlier this year, was top scorer in the Champions League last season with 11 goals and scored 18 in the Primera Division. However, the teams in the Champions League final lost out on the Best Club award, which went to Pep Guardiola's Manchester City who won a fourth Premier League title in five years.
